Skier bashes Salomon skis in front of company higher-up.

Skier Michael Pearson was standing in line at Jackson Hole‘s Bridger Gondola when he noticed another person with a pair of Salomon skis. Appearing to talk to his buddy, he begins to discuss how he disliked the Salomon QSTs, saying they “felt like skiing on a limp noodle”. He then proceeds to say that he liked the Atomic Bent Chetler skis a lot more, all without realizing that the President of Salomon is apparently standing in line right in front of him.

It’s not clear if the person standing in front of him is Salomon’s President of the Americas Steven Doolan, Salomon President & CEO Guillaume Meyzenq, or some other higher up at Salomon and the woman in the video just failed to recognize his actual title, but it’s pretty epic no matter which way.

Everyone is entitled to their own opinions about skis and people are going to have different experiences on gear, no matter what. I’d imagine the president, no matter what position he holds, understands that and wasn’t deeply offended or angered by the incident. If anything he probably thought it was funny. I sure would have.

Also, Salomon and Atomic are both Amer Sports brands, so the parent company is getting their money either way.
